diff -r 41f0cfe18c80 -r c734af59ce98 kernel/eka/include/drivers/mmc.h --- a/kernel/eka/include/drivers/mmc.h Tue Apr 27 18:02:57 2010 +0300 +++ b/kernel/eka/include/drivers/mmc.h Tue May 11 17:28:22 2010 +0300 @@ -1540,7 +1540,8 @@ enum TCardTypes { EHighSpeedCard26Mhz = 0x01, - EHighSpeedCard52Mhz = 0x02 + EHighSpeedCard52Mhz = 0x02, + ECardTypeMsk = 0x03 }; /** @@ -1714,6 +1715,9 @@ /** returns the contents of the S_A_TIMEOUT field */ inline TUint SleepAwakeTimeout() const; + + /** returns True if the CARD_TYPE field conatains a valid value **/ + inline TBool IsSupportedCardType() const; private: /**